Theres like a ball joint in left hand top corner (drivers side headlight) if you pull the headlight in that corner it should pop off just go easy because the clips are temprementelAnd the same go's for the Pside headlight but the ball joint will be in the top right conerOhh and as Luke has said take the indicators out..Also make sure the wires are disconected from the headlight befor you start pulling lol Edited October 14, 2012 by micky boy Quote Link to post Share on other sites
Broony Posted October 14, 2012 Share Posted October 14, 2012 Take indicators outUnclip wiringUndo 10mm nutUndo top clip and wiggle it until its free, be careful as they are brittle.Undo bottom clip and wiggle free by pulling up wards just check the clips are clear and that you not going to break them.
